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ities

While Menheniot station might not boast a comprehensive set of amenities, it is designed to cater to the essentials of any traveler's journey. There is no ticket office or ticket machines, so it’s advisable to purchase your tickets online beforehand. The station features a customer help point, available to assist with travel inquiries and other needs. Although there are no accessible ticket machines, induction loops are present to aid those with hearing impairments.

Travelers can enjoy step-free access to parts of the station. However, if you're heading towards the Plymouth-bound platform, be prepared to use a footbridge, as this area is not step-free. For those planning road visits, the station offers 15 free car parking spaces, although there are no accessible parking spaces or bicycle storage facilities. As for creature comforts, you won't find any shops or refreshment facilities, so pack your snacks and drinks. Divert your connectivity needs to the GWR Free Station WiFi available on-site.

Everything you need to know about Smallbrook Junction Station

Exploring Smallbrook Junction Train Station

Tucked away on the picturesque Isle of Wight, Smallbrook Junction is a unique train station that serves as a vital interchange point rather than a bustling hub for daily commuters. This charming station primarily facilitates connections with the Island Line and the Isle of Wight Steam Railway, making it a hidden gem for steam train enthusiasts and history buffs. While Smallbrook Junction might not offer the conveniences of larger stations, it boasts a unique character and a strategic position that draws visitors from far and wide.

Facilities and Amenities at Smallbrook Junction Station

Unlike most train stations, Smallbrook Junction does not feature a ticket office or ticket machines, meaning you will need to purchase your tickets beforehand or via alternative means, such as online. Travelers will find a few helpful amenities including an induction loop and customer help points. The station serves as an interchange, so while there are no direct road access points, assistance is provided for boarding and alighting trains by the train's guard. Travelers with special needs can utilize ramps for accessible train access, ensuring a smooth transition for all passengers.

However, it's worth noting the absence of waiting rooms, accessible toilets, and refreshment facilities. Instead, this station focuses on connectivity and ease of use, perfectly suiting its role as a quaint interchange for the Island's public transportation network.
